Who manages the transfer of digital photo libraries (Apple Photos, Google Photos) to a family shared drive?
Summary:
Alix manages the transfer of digital photo libraries to a family shared drive. The service navigates cloud account access to preserve and distribute digital memories to the family.
Direct Answer:
Digital photos are often the most cherished assets but accessing them from Apple or Google accounts after death is technically difficult. Alix facilitates the process of gaining legal access to these digital accounts or utilizing legacy contact features. Once access is secured the team downloads the photo libraries and organizes them onto a hard drive or a secure cloud server accessible to the family.
This service ensures that years of memories are not deleted due to inactivity or lost passwords. Alix handles the technical migration so that the family can easily view and share the photos preserving the personal legacy of the deceased without needing technical expertise.
